You will either have to reach out to Customer Care at 611 or send a DM to T-Mobile Facebook or Twitter to see if it is possible to revert the plan.  If the plan she changed from is a grandfathered plan that is not longer available.  It will not be possible to return to something the system no longer has to offer.

I’m not sure of all of the specifics yet, it was an over 55 plan, but the big one is the hot spot changes. Used to be unlimited high speed (with throttling for the biggest users “at times when the network needs it”) to now being 50Gigs of high speed before switching to 600k. She was promised there were no differences. Also, one plus international is $25 a month extra now for whatever that is, and I don’t think it was that before.

looks like shes now on the Go5G Plus 55 plan.

 

for the unlimited hot spot deal there..their cut off for what they would consider a abuser of data would be anywhere between 30-50GB...then they dump them down to 3G speeds..now they just have it set in stone as the cut off..i rarely go over 20GB of data just on the phone and i consider myself a decent enough power user..

 

and drastically less for hotspot usage..
